Kiyosaki Slams Treasury Buybacks: Calls them 'QE', Backs Bitcoin

Financial expert Robert Kiyosaki has weighed in on recent market developments, calling the US Treasury's expanded buyback program 'Quantitative Easing' (QE). Speaking to a news outlet, Kiyosaki expressed his concerns about the potential consequences of this policy, which he believes could lead to inflation and devalue the dollar. He instead advocates for holding Bitcoin as a safe-haven asset.

Kiyosaki's comments come amid rising tensions between the US government and major financial institutions over the expanded buyback program. Critics argue that it will only serve to enrich large corporations at the expense of ordinary citizens, while proponents see it as a necessary measure to stabilize the economy.

The financial expert has long been an advocate for individual freedom and self-sufficiency, often cautioning against relying on traditional forms of wealth such as stocks or bonds. His endorsement of Bitcoin reflects his broader views on the importance of diversification and protecting one's assets from potential market downturns.
